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Ubah Tanggal menjadi Format Tanggal MYSQL

Pertama buat SimpleDateFormat untuk menguraikan masukan Anda dari UI:

SimpleDateFormat sdf = new SimpleDateFormat("MMM dd, yyyy");

Selanjutnya parsing input ke dalam java.sql.Date (sayangnya bernama dan berbeda dari java.util.Date ). Jadi misalnya:

java.sql.Date date = new java.sql.Date(sdf.parse(fromDate).getTime());

Terakhir gunakan date untuk diteruskan ke JDBC saat membuat kueri basis data Anda. Seperti:

Connection con; // assuming you have a database connection
PreparedStatement ps = con.prepareStatement("SELECT * FROM table WHERE x = ?");
ps.setDate(1, date);
ResultSet resultSet = ps.executeQuery();



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. SUBDATE() Contoh – MySQL

  2. Bagaimana saya bisa memeriksa apakah ada tabel MySQL dengan PHP?

  3. objek django+mysql='DatabaseWrapper' tidak memiliki atribut 'Database' error

  4. Laravel:PDOException:tidak dapat menemukan driver

  5. Cara menjalankan skrip PHP pada waktu yang dijadwalkan